Position Profile
Position requires the ability to serve as a key member of the project design team aiding in the development of construction plans for civil sitework projects. This position will fall within our Power Market, who serve clients with the energy generation and transmission industries. This person is expected to work as an integral member of multidisciplinary design teams to plan and execute projects for a variety of clients including utility providers and private industry, but may also include, at times, local, state, and federal governments.Conceptual and final site design services for new facilities and infrastructure, site renovations and expansions will be common tasks, and span site geometry, grading, utility design, drainage/stormwater management design, development of construction cost estimates, and feasibility studies.

A Day in Life of a Civil Sitework Designer at Hanson
As a civil sitework designer in the Power Market your daily tasks will be broad in nature, but focused on engineering, modeling, and plan production, all with sustainability, resiliency, and the environment in mind. Interaction with regulatory agencies and districts, and utility providers will be expected.

Here is a snapshot of what you would do in this role:
Develop and direct development of civil sitework construction plans utilizing AutoCAD/Civil 3D software
Perform design calculations, utilize computer software for simulation, modeling, analysis and design, and work efficiently with other team members for project completion.
Occasional construction observation on project sites will be expected.
Collaborate with Senior Technical Staff and Project Managers.
